Output 90836694b593e1add9dabce3bbe6c3a895d5cc0d5fcf3a22e7008c6a191d4eba:1

value
2530104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8813002e9a1f04155e2553fa040705ca6d8367d OP_EQUAL
address
3H3zCswvrP2ApMhLHn9iDpFWRLAAk2qdNb
transaction
90836694b593e1add9dabce3bbe6c3a895d5cc0d5fcf3a22e7008c6a191d4eba
spent
true